Pull out the locking pin (D) to release from the groove (DN).
•
Twist the locking pin 90 degrees to release it permanently.
•
Turn the twist grip (C) to open the grinding jar support.
•
Only remove the grinding jar with closed lid.
•
Only open the grinding jar in a safe position (e.g. extraction device).
•
Only open the grinding jar once it has cooled down.

5.5.2
Closing
With this grinding device, a very large amount of energy enters the sample
material.
•
Therefore make sure that the grinding jar support has been closed properly.
•
Before grinding check the lock on the grinding jar support (V).
Fig. 21: Locking the grinding jar support
The twist grip (C) of the grinding jar support (G) is secured by locking pin (D) to
prevent inadvertent opening.
•
Twist the locking pin (D) until it engages in the groove (DN).
